Target audience
The LORDWORLD ESP32-P4-WIFI6-POE-ETH is a development board built for makers and engineers working on IoT edge devices. It combines an ESP32-P4 core module with an ESP32-C6-MINI module to deliver rich human-machine interfaces and integrated AI speech interaction capabilities. The board targets projects needing local processing power alongside cloud connectivity for voice-driven applications.
Memory capacity and headroom
The board provides 32MB of PSRAM and 32MB of onboard NOR flash for the main processor. This memory pool handles the ESP32-P4 firmware, buffered sensor data, and intermediate buffers for voice processing pipelines. Complex AI models requiring larger weight storage or heavy multitasking will exceed the available capacity and need external storage.
Thermals noise and power
The board supports PoE power supply, delivering both network connectivity and power through a single Ethernet cable. This simplifies deployment in enclosed or remote locations where separate power wiring is impractical. No active cooling is present, so sustained high-load operation relies on passive dissipation within the enclosure.

Will the board's single Ethernet cable provide both data and power to my existing PoE switch?
Yes, the board supports PoE so one Ethernet cable delivers network connectivity and power from a compatible PoE switch or injector.
How can I confirm the ESP32-P4 core and ESP32-C6 modules are communicating over the SDIO link after power-up?
Check the serial console for SDIO initialisation messages and verify Wi-Fi 6 and Bluetooth 5 discovery; successful link shows both radios active.
Does the package include the 32 MB PSRAM and 32 MB NOR flash already soldered, or must I add memory myself?
The ESP32-P4 core module ships with 32 MB PSRAM and 32 MB NOR flash onboard; no separate memory purchase is needed.
